如何安全、彻底地删除VPN设置,网络工程师的完整指南

hsakd223 2026-01-28 vpn加速器 5 0

在当今高度互联的数字环境中,虚拟私人网络(VPN)已成为保护隐私、绕过地理限制和增强网络安全的重要工具,随着需求变化或设备更换,用户可能需要彻底删除原有的VPN配置,尤其是在离职交接、设备回收或安全合规审计等场景中,作为一名网络工程师,我深知,简单地“删除”一个VPN连接并不等于完全清除所有痕迹,本文将从技术角度出发,详细讲解如何安全、彻底地删除各类操作系统中的VPN设置,确保不留隐患。

我们需要明确“删除VPN设置”的含义,这不仅包括移除配置文件、注销账户信息,还应涵盖清除缓存数据、密钥链(Keychain)存储、证书以及与之相关的日志记录,若仅删除图形界面中的连接项,而忽略后台服务或系统级配置,仍可能被恶意软件或追踪工具恢复访问权限。

以Windows为例,删除本地VPN设置需分三步操作:

  1. 打开“设置 > 网络和Internet > VPN”,找到对应连接并点击“删除”;
  2. 进入“控制面板 > 网络和共享中心 > 更改适配器设置”,右键点击对应的VPN适配器,选择“卸载设备”;
  3. 通过命令行运行 netsh interface ipv4 show interfacesnetsh interface ipv6 show interfaces 检查是否存在残留接口,必要时用 netsh interface set interface "VPN名称" admin=disabled 禁用后手动删除。

在macOS上,步骤类似但更依赖终端命令,打开“系统设置 > 网络”,移除相关连接后,还需进入终端执行:

sudo networksetup -deletevpncongfig "连接名"

同时检查钥匙串访问(Keychain Access),删除与该VPN关联的证书和密码条目,防止下次自动登录。

对于Linux用户(如Ubuntu),若使用NetworkManager管理,则可通过GUI或命令行:

nmcli connection delete "连接名"

还需清理 /etc/NetworkManager/system-connections/ 目录下的配置文件,并重启NetworkManager服务。

特别提醒:若使用的是企业级或第三方VPN客户端(如Cisco AnyConnect、OpenVPN GUI等),必须通过其自带的“注销”功能退出账号,然后彻底卸载软件本身,某些客户端会在系统启动项中注册自启服务,需手动禁用(如Windows的“任务管理器 > 启动”或Linux的systemctl disable)。

也是最容易被忽视的一点:清除日志和临时文件,许多VPN客户端会记录连接历史、IP地址变更和认证信息,建议使用专用工具(如CCleaner或Windows内置磁盘清理)扫描并删除这些潜在敏感数据。

删除VPN设置不是一键操作,而是一个涉及系统层面、应用层和数据存储的多维度过程,作为网络工程师,我们不仅要帮助用户完成表面操作,更要保障其数字资产的安全边界,遵循以上步骤,你不仅能彻底移除旧VPN配置,还能为新环境的部署打下坚实基础,网络安全始于细节,也成于严谨。

如何安全、彻底地删除VPN设置,网络工程师的完整指南